| Course contents : | Three topics will be covered during the lectures: Internet, information systems and information processing systems, spreadsheets (Excel) |
 |
| Course objective : | The main goal is to present and to familiarize the students with the tools they will certainly use during their professional life. We want also to open their mind and to prepare them to the future evolutions of their work implied by the adoption of new technologies. |
